Moonlight Peaks, developed by Little Chicken, is a single player farming simulator game that combines the supernatural with the natural, the cozy with the gothic. Set in the magical town of Moonlight Peaks, the game centers around a vampire who has moved into their family’s abandoned farmstead. This vampire persona and the farmstead are customizable, granting players the chance to fit their character and home to their tastes. Players can also adopt a three-eyed hell kitten pet into their farms.
The game includes seven families, consisting of werewolves, witches, ghosts, seers, humans, mermaids, and fellow vampires. Players can befriend or romance the locals, uncovering secrets about the town and each family. There are two dozen romanceable characters for players to choose from, but that is not all the game has to offer.
Farming in Moonlight Peaks takes on a unique experience as the game features enchanted crops and mystical livestock. Crops must be harvested by moonlight, revamping the farming style by using a nocturnal time cycle. Players can also learn paranormal farming techniques that can range from helping crops grow faster to making harvesting easier. Some of the mystical livestock includes the draculambs and piggoats with more to be revealed at launch.
Other magical abilities include potion-making, spell-casting, and transfiguration. There are potions that allow players to change their appearance and spells useful for resource gathering. Spells and potions can be learned from the witches in town, encouraging players to interact with the NPCs.
